Constant Change

Anonymous employee
Recommend
CEO approval
Business outlook

Pros

Wonderful people to work with. Some have been there for more than a decade. Good for anyone who likes a challenging, never boring environment. The company is going through many changes even on a daily basis. Location working to be R&D center of excellence. Good for engineers. Flex time is a nice perk.

Cons

Private equity owned with many deliverables (Scott Dennis is no longer the CEO of the company). The pace is hectic and chaotic. You're lucky if you get anything done on your 'to do' list as priorities shift so quickly. The stress level is perpetually high and felt by most (if not all) employees. Longer hours are typical (45-55 per week) for salaried employees. More than 10 rounds of layoffs in the last couple of years due to cost cutting / restructuring. Morale is low.
